About

Eminem Holding a Rocket Launcher is an image macro series featuring a pair of screenshots from the music video for "Godzilla" by Eminem and featuring Juice Wrld. The top image in the meme shows a man in a black mask pointing a pistol at Eminem. Directly under the image is another screenshot from the video that features Eminem pointing a rocket launcher at the masked man. The image has inspired a number of object labeling memes.

Orign

On March 9th, 2020, the YouTube account Lyrical Lemonade uploaded the music video for the song "Godzilla" by Eminem and featuring Juice WRLD. In the video, a man in a black mask threatens Eminem with a pistol. Eminem responds by pointing a rocket launcher at the man. Within two days, the post received more than 24 million views (shown below).



Spread

Hours later, on March 10th, Redditor [1] mijuzz7 shared one of the earliest known versions of the two-panel meme (shown below, left). This example features the man labeled "My dad telling me I'm adopted and Eminem is labeled "Me calling him a virgin." Within 24 hours, the meme received more than 8,300 points (95% upvoted). Over the next 24 hours, people continued to share variations of the meme (example below, center).

The following day, Redditor[2] famsteve20015 shared a variation in which the masked man is labeled "Kanye". The post received more than 11,000 points (86% upvoted) and 165 comments in less than 24 hours (shown below, center).
